*Two-year Post-doctoral Position
*

*
*
/

/Multimodal data analysis of behavioral and physiological signals from 
human-human and human-machine interactions/

/
/
*deadline for application : 30 October*
/

/Laboratoire d’Informatique et des Systèmes (LIS) et Laboratoire Parole 
et Langage (LPL) /

Aix-Marseille Université & CNRS

*_Keywords:_* conversational speech, multimodal data analysis, 
neurophysiological data, machine learning

The A*MIDEX project /PhysSocial/ aims at a betterunderstanding of the 
specificities of social interactions by comparing relationships between 
behavior and neurophysiologyin human‐human and human‐robot discussion. 
The goal of the post-doc is toanalyze the multimodal signals (speech, 
eyes direction, physiological, and neurophysiologic signals) from 
conversational activity using signal processing and machine learning 
methodologies in order to compare the human-human and human-robot 
interactions.

The Post-doc is organized around 2 main tasks:

  * /Multimodal data preprocessing/: in a first step, the objective is
    to process the row data (speech, transcribed speech, eyes tracking,
    physiological and neurophysiological signals) corresponding to
    human-human and human-robot conversation in order to extract time
    series corresponding to behavioral features, as well as cognitive
    events derived from local activity in well-defined brain areas
    involved inlanguage and social cognition
  * /Machine learning of causal relations: /in a second step,//time
    series will be used by statistical learning to identify causal
    relations between behavioral and physiological features and
    cognitive events extracted from neurophysiological recording with
    fMRI. From a learning point of view, one challenge in this project
    is the high-dimensional data. We address this issue with a focus on
    the features representation and selection problems.

The candidate should have a Phd in Computer Science, Applied 
Mathematics, Signal or Natural Language Processing (with solid 
background in machine learning).

The candidate should have a strong background in machine learning and 
signal processing with a focus on multimodality. Some complementary 
previous experience would be appreciated in the following topics:
• Multimodal data processing
• Data science applied to language data


The post-doc is fully funded during 2 years as part of the A*MIDEX 
interdisciplinary project PhysSocial, including personalized training, 
travel expenses, and conferences attendance.

French language is not required.
